Furthermore, What does asada mean in carne asada?

Carne asada, which in English means « grilled meat, » is beef. For this Mexican dish, one-inch-thick steaks are marinated in lime juice and seasonings, grilled, and then cut into thin strips. Carne asada is either served as a main course typically with rice and beans, or used as a filling for tacos or burritos.

Simply so, What are carnitas tacos made of?

Carnitas are the Mexican version of pulled pork. It’s traditionally made with pork shoulder (also known as pork butt) because of the higher fat content, which helps the meat stay super tender and juicy while it’s cooked.

What part is carne asada?

Carne asada is traditionally made using skirt steak or flank steak. The two cuts are very similar and can be used interchangeably. The two meat cuts do have a few differences. Flank steak is a more lean option and has a great, intense meaty flavor.

What is the difference between Pernil and carnitas?

Carnitas are pieces of fried pork meat, often cooked with orange rind for a distinctive flavor. Pernil is a pork shoulder marinated overnight in sofrito, slices of garlic, adobo and sazón. In America, especially the northeast pernil is traditionally roasted in the oven.

Why do Mexicans call carne asada?

The term carne asada translates literally to « grilled meat »; the English-style dish « roast beef » is called by its English name in Spanish, so that each dish has a distinctive name. The term carne asada is used in Latin America and refers to the style of grilled meat in those countries.

How was carne asada invented?

Carne asada tacos are the first tacos in history. It is believed that the first tacos appeared in the 1500s, made with thin slices of meat cooked over hot coals. The meat was placed in a corn tortilla and topped with guacamole, onions, chili peppers, and lime – also known as the carne asada taco.

What cut is best for carne asada?

Best cut of beef for Carne Asada

The BEST cuts for the Mexican version of the dish we all know and love are either skirt steak or flank steak. Personally, I prefer skirt steak (pictured). It’s more tender and flavourful than flank and can be cooked well done (for those who prefer well) without getting tough and chewy.
